区块链技术自2010年比特币问世以来,便成为全球金融科技领域中的一项革命性技术。比特币作为第一个实现区块链技术的应用,使用了密码学来确保交易的安全性与匿名性。区块链的核心在于去中心化的数据结构,而比特币则是建立在这一技术基础之上的数字货币。本文将深入探讨区块链的基本原理、比特币的密码技术、安全性,以及它们如何协同工作。
区块链是一种去中心化的账本技术,其结构由一个个“区块”组成,这些区块相互链接形成一个“链”,每个区块中存储着多笔交易数据。区块链的运行依赖于分布式网络中的节点共同维护,这使得其具有高度的安全性与透明性。
每个区块包含一个时间戳、前一个区块的哈希值以及当前区块的交易数据。当新交易发生时,网络中的节点会进行验证,并将其打包成新的区块;待验证完成后,该区块便会添加至区块链上。此过程确保了数据的唯一性和不可篡改性。
比特币作为一种数字货币,其安全性主要依赖于密码学技术。最基础的部分,称为“公钥加密”,用户在创建比特币钱包时,会生成一对密钥:公钥和私钥。公钥如同银行账户,任何人都可以使用它向你转账;而私钥则如同密码,必须妥善保管,任何人获取私钥都能控制你的钱包。
比特币交易中,用户用私钥对交易进行签名,验证该交易的真实性;而其他节点通过公钥验证该笔交易是否确实来自其声称的发送者。通过这一方式,比特币用户不仅可以保护自己的资产,也确保交易数据的安全。
区块链的安全性主要来源于其去中心化的特性,任何单一节点都无法操纵或篡改区块链的数据。此外,区块链使用了一种叫“共识机制”的算法,该算法确保网络中的节点在添加新交易前必须达成一致。这让区块链极难被攻击或伪造。
相对比特币来说,其使用的工作量证明(Proof of Work)机制,要求节点进行复杂的数学计算,只有计算出哈希值后,才能将新区块添加到链上。这个过程不仅成本高昂,而且耗时,使得攻击者几乎无法控制网络。
区块链和比特币都拥有广泛的应用潜力,除了数字货币外,区块链可在供应链管理、身份验证、数字资产交易等多个领域发挥巨大作用。而比特币则作为一种新型的投资资产,吸引了越来越多的机构投资者。
例如,在供应链中,区块链技术可以确保每一环节的透明度,提高效率、降低成本;在数字资产交易中,区块链保证了资产的唯一性和不可篡改性,极大地减少了欺诈活动。
随着区块链技术的不断发展,未来我们或将看到更智能的合约技术(智能合约)与区块链的结合,为各行各业带来革命性的变革。比特币作为数字货币的先行者,也可能在未来的金融体系中发挥更加重要的角色。
1. 区块链技术如何保证数据的安全性?
区块链利用去中心化、共识机制以及加密算法来保障数据的安全性...
2. 比特币和其他数字货币有什么区别?
比特币是最早的数字货币,而其他数字货币则可能在技术、发行机制等方面有所不同...
3. 如何安全地存储比特币?
存储比特币最安全的方法是使用硬件钱包,它能够离线存储私钥...
4. 区块链在金融以外的领域有哪些应用?
除了金融,区块链在医疗、地产、游戏等行业也展现出巨大的应用潜力...
5. 为什么区块链被称为“不可篡改”技术?
由于区块链的结构设计和共识机制,使得一旦数据被写入区块链,就几乎不可能进行修改...
6. 比特币的未来发展方向是什么?
比特币未来可能会朝着更加合规的方向发展,为其在传统金融市场中的接受提供保障...
以上为主题相关内容的框架和问题思考。在具体问题展开时,可以结合实例、数据分析及专家观点,深入阐述每个问题的具体内容达800字。